Chapter 6 Meeting Derick

  • Joana woke up with a slight headache as she clutched the side of her stomach, the wound was no longer there. Was it a dream? She noticed that she didn’t wake up in her room. This place looked different, it looked historical as there were a lot of ancient art and drawings on the wall and the roof. She got down from the bed and tried to look if she would see anyone who would explain what had happened to her. She also noticed that the room was very dark, the large windows covered by thick black curtains. Even though the room was dark, she could somehow still see. She walked to the window and was about to open the curtains when she heard a voice behind her.
  • “I wouldn’t do that if I were you. The sun will roast you like marshmallows.”
  • She turned to see another strange face standing at the door. She recognized him; it was the man who had stabbed her at the wedding.
